    That would help reduce costs and provide more flexibility, said William Metz, manager of global services and IT external business development at The Procter & Gamble Co. in Cincinnati.

    P&G, which in 2003 outsourced its IT infrastructure to Hewlett-Packard Co. and its human resources operations to IBM, has adopted standard business processes internally and said it wants vendors industrywide to do likewise."We're going to push the industry in this direction," Metz said.If processes become standardized, he added, "then I can unplug [one vendor] and plug in someone else."
